The Role of Random Number Generators (RNGs)
The fairness and unpredictability of Plinko are ensured by the use of Random Number Generators (RNGs). These sophisticated algorithms generate a sequence of numbers that dictate the ball’s movement and final destination. Reputable online casinos employ certified RNGs that are regularly audited by independent organizations to guarantee impartiality. Understanding that each drop is independent – meaning past outcomes do not influence future results – is crucial. Players should avoid falling for the gambler’s fallacy, the belief that a particular outcome is ‘due’ after a series of different results. The RNG ensures that every drop is a fresh start with the same underlying probabilistic distribution.

The Art of Bet Sizing
Effective bet sizing is critical for long-term success in Plinko. A common approach is to use a proportional betting strategy, where the bet size is adjusted in relation to the player’s bankroll. For instance, a conservative player might risk only 1% to 2% of their bankroll on each drop, while a more aggressive player might risk up to 5%. However, higher risk comes with the potential for faster depletion of funds. Another technique is the Martingale system, which involves doubling the bet after each loss, aiming to recover previous losses with a single win. While this can be effective in the short term, it requires a substantial bankroll and carries significant risk, as a prolonged losing streak can quickly exhaust available funds. It's crucial to understand the inherent dangers of any betting system and to adapt it to one's individual risk profile.

Recognizing Problem Gambling
Problem gambling manifests in various ways, often starting subtly and escalating over time. Common warning signs include constantly thinking about the game, lying to family and friends about gambling activities, borrowing money to gamble, and experiencing mood swings related to wins and losses. Individuals struggling with gambling addiction may also exhibit withdrawal symptoms, such as irritability, anxiety, and restlessness, when they try to stop. It's vital to be honest with yourself and others if you suspect you have a gambling problem. Several resources are available to provide support and guidance, including helplines, counseling services, and self-exclusion programs.
